verb[T]
to make or create something; to produce something by work or action
tsukuru
Pronunciation
Etymology
Native Japanese verb, attested in Old Japanese as tukuru, meaning broadly 'to make, build, prepare.'
Examples
彼は木で椅子を作る。
kare wa ki de isu o tsukuru
He makes chairs out of wood.
子どもたちは砂で城を作った。
kodomotachi wa suna de shiro o tsukutta
The children made a castle out of sand.
